Understanding Professional Gutter Repair Significance in Toronto's Climate

While gutters may appear straightforward, Toronto's freeze-thaw cycles, substantial spring downpours, and sudden lake-effect storms convert minor defects into expensive water damage rapidly. You require repairs that withstand ice accumulation, fast drainage, and wind-blown water without breaking down. Professional technicians identify pitch problems, seam separations, loose hardware, and insufficient downspout flow, then fix them to restore reliable drainage.

They also choose materials and sealants that handle weather extremes, boosting climate resilience and extending service life. Properly sized outlets, leaf protection, and secure hangers keep water moving, protect fascia, and stop water infiltration. With targeted seasonal maintenance, you'll identify small issues before they escalate to serious damage. Professional repairs preserve your home's exterior features-and maintain your insurance eligibility and home value.

Available Services and Cost Ranges

After finding trusted professionals, pay attention to what they actually provide and what it costs in Toronto. Look for free estimates, written scopes, photos of deficiencies, and specific timelines. Main offerings encompass leak tracing and sealing, downspout modifications, component replacements, sealing mitre joints, repairs to hangers and fascia, rebuilding corners, and guard installations. Numerous providers bundle cleaning and seasonal inspections to detect problems before they worsen.

Typical cost ranges for gutter services include: basic cleaning costs $150-$350 for an average house; minor leak patching or resealing ranges from $150-$400; installing replacement sections $12-$20 per linear foot; full gutter system replacement (aluminum, seamless) $18-$35 per linear foot; new downspout installation $150-$300 each; debris guards $8-$18 per linear foot; fascia/soffit maintenance $15-$30 per linear foot; emergency service calls typically add $100-$250. Always confirm warranties and disposal fees.

Essential Tips for Preventing Leaks, Ice Dams, and Foundation Damage

Prior to booking maintenance, prevent issues by managing water and heat at the source. Maintain clear gutters; add Gutter guards to stop debris from blocking downspouts. Fasten hangers, repair joints, and verify troughs angle toward outlets to prevent water pooling. Install Downspout extensions to direct runoff a minimum of 6-10 feet from the foundation, and slope soil to slope away from the house.

Combat ice dams by improving attic insulation and weatherization to keep roof decks at low temperatures. Properly ventilate soffits and ridges for steady airflow; rake snow with a roof rake prior to it refreezes. Protect vulnerable valleys with protective membranes. Channel sump and discharge lines away from sidewalks and foundations. Inspect after big storms, and fix small issues immediately to prevent costly damage.

Do Toronto Bylaws Require Permits for Gutter Replacements or Downspout Relocation

In most cases, you don't need a building permit for direct gutter replacements in Toronto, however you need to follow property standards and drainage regulations. Moving downspouts can trigger permits if you alter the structure, heritage features, or tie into sewers. You must comply with the Downspout Disconnection Bylaw and stormwater rules. If changes affect setbacks, lot grading, or conservation areas, you should expect proper approvals or zoning variances. Be sure to check with Toronto Building and Right-of-Way Management.

What Warranties Do Contractors Typically Offer on Labor and Materials

Construction professionals usually extend work guarantees lasting 1-5 years, as manufacturers offer material guarantees spanning 20-50 years, potentially indefinite warranties on metal materials. Make sure to check protection details: water penetration, structural issues, hardware problems, and sealants. Inquire whether environmental damage and craftsmanship issues are guaranteed, what cancels the guarantee, and whether it can be transferred. Demand written terms, verification of product registration, and a dedicated representative for warranty issues. Schedule regular maintenance visits to preserve protection.

Are Eco-Friendly or Rainwater Harvesting Gutter Options Available in My Area?

Yes, local dealers and professionals offer rainwater harvesting systems and eco-friendly options. You can choose water storage tanks with water quality controls, protective screens, and pump fittings. For materials, evaluate aluminum or steel with recycled content, or eco-friendly gutter alternatives for low-impact projects. Make certain components meet building codes, include mosquito-proof screens, and match capacity to collection surface and precipitation. Ask for quality certifications and upkeep requirements before buying.
